Majority of B.C. drivers nervous in winter conditions

Poll conducted for ICBC shows that top concern is other drivers being unprepared for snowy and icy conditions
winter-driving
Survey says! that majority of B.C. drivers feel uncomfortable driving in winter conditions.

In news that should surprise no one, Metro Vancouver drivers are more nervous when it comes to driving in winter conditions than drivers in the rest of the province.

The results come courtesy of an Ipsos poll conducted for ICBC. Although 60 per cent of the drivers surveyed said that winter driving conditions put them on edge, 64 per cent of Metro Vancouver drivers felt this way, compared with 55 per cent of drivers elsewhere.
